§ 721.11. Public notification
(a) General rule.--The permittee of a public water supply system shall, as soon as practicable, give public notification whenever the public water supply system:
(1) is not in compliance with the regulations adopted to comply with national primary drinking water regulations;
(2) fails to perform monitoring as required by the drinking water standards;
(3) is subject to a variance granted for an inability to meet a maximum contaminant level requirement;
(4) is subject to an exemption; or
(5) fails to comply with the requirements prescribed by a variance or exemption.
(b) Newspaper notice.--Such notice shall be given by the permittee by publication in a newspaper of general circulation within the area served by such water system at least once every three months so long as the violation, variance or exemption continues.
(c) Direct notice.--Such notice shall also be given with the water bills or in writing to the customer at least once every three months so long as the violation, variance or exemption continues.
(d) Noncommunity water systems.--If the public water system is a noncommunity water system, the notice shall be given by conspicuous posting, in a location where it can be seen by consumers, rather than in the manner specified in subsections (b) and (c).
(e) Alternate notice.--The department may prescribe alternative notice requirements for violations of other regulations adopted pursuant to this act.
